In her latest track “FREE MY N*GGA,” Sexyy Red witnesses the song’s viral surge on TikTok. Fans creatively repurpose the lyrics, but controversy arises when a TikTok user linked to a murder case incorporates the song into a video. This user, part of the infamous “E and J Gang” couple account, faced legal consequences for a Georgia murder last year.

Sexyy Red’s tweet sharing the video with the caption “Free Dat!!” sparked criticism online. Commenters urged her to reconsider, questioning her awareness of the man’s criminal history. Yet, some defended Red, citing a double standard within the hip-hop community, where calls for freedom for individuals with criminal backgrounds are not uncommon.
Opinions are divided, with fans expressing contrasting views on social media. Some emphasize the hypocrisy of condemning Red while overlooking similar instances in the hip-hop world.
